O comando watch

O comando watch

O comando watch, do shell, serve para exibir o resultado de outro comando de forma contínua. Atualizando a cada n segundos, sendo n, por padrão, 2 segundos.

Alguns parâmetros e exemplos básicos:

# Exibe a data e hora. Atualiza a cada 2 segundos.
watch date

Para interromper use CTRL+C

# Exibe a data e hora. Atualiza a cada 1 segundo.
watch -n 1 date
# Exibe informações sobre a memória, atualiza a cada 1 segundo.
# -d mostra o que foi alterado em destaque
# -t remove a linha de cabeçalho
watch -n 1 -d -t free -h